Below the platform, a cascade of verdant foliage spills outwards, softening the rigid lines of the structure and adding a sense of organic abundance to the scene. The artist employed a restrained palette; the dominant colors are earthy browns, muted greens, and subtle yellows, contributing to an overall feeling of tranquility and quiet observation.
The arrangement evokes themes of captivity and freedom. While the bird is depicted in a naturalistic pose, its placement on the suspended platform implies a degree of constraint or artificiality. The bamboo poles, stark against the background, emphasize this sense of imposed order. However, the presence of the lush foliage hints at an attempt to integrate the constructed environment with nature, perhaps suggesting a desire for harmony between human intervention and the natural world.
The composition’s vertical format reinforces the feeling of height and suspension, drawing the viewers eye upwards towards the bird and then downwards along the cascading foliage. The signature or inscription in the lower left corner adds an element of personal authorship and cultural context, though its meaning remains inaccessible without further information. Overall, the work invites contemplation on the relationship between nature, artifice, and the delicate balance between freedom and constraint.
